Home
last modified time | relevance | path

Searched refs:PyMemberDef (Results 1 – 25 of 111) sorted by relevance

12345

/external/python/cpython3/Include/
Ddescrobject.h29 PyAPI_FUNC(PyObject *) PyDescr_NewMember(PyTypeObject *, PyMemberDef *);
41 struct PyMemberDef { struct
88 PyAPI_FUNC(PyObject *) PyMember_GetOne(const char *, PyMemberDef *);
89 PyAPI_FUNC(int) PyMember_SetOne(char *, PyMemberDef *, PyObject *);
Dpytypedefs.h16 typedef struct PyMemberDef PyMemberDef; typedef
/external/python/cpython3/Modules/_testlimitedcapi/
Dheaptype_relative.c178 static PyMemberDef *
181 PyMemberDef *def = PyType_GetSlot(Py_TYPE(self), Py_tp_members); in heaptype_with_member_extract_and_check_memb()
210 PyMemberDef *def = heaptype_with_member_extract_and_check_memb(self); in heaptype_with_member_get_memb()
217 PyMemberDef *def = heaptype_with_member_extract_and_check_memb(self); in heaptype_with_member_set_memb()
228 PyMemberDef *def = heaptype_with_member_extract_and_check_memb(self); in get_memb_offset()
235 PyMemberDef def = {"memb", Py_T_BYTE, sizeof(PyObject), Py_RELATIVE_OFFSET}; in heaptype_with_member_get_memb_relative()
242 PyMemberDef def = {"memb", Py_T_BYTE, sizeof(PyObject), Py_RELATIVE_OFFSET}; in heaptype_with_member_set_memb_relative()
283 PyMemberDef members[] = { in make_heaptype_with_member()
Dvectorcall_limited.c157 static PyMemberDef LimitedVectorCallClass_members[] = {
/external/python/cpython3/Doc/c-api/
Dstructures.rst440 .. c:type:: PyMemberDef
452 A NULL value marks the end of a ``PyMemberDef[]`` array.
459 See :ref:`PyMemberDef-types` for the possible values.
467 Zero or more of the :ref:`PyMemberDef-flags`, combined using bitwise OR.
475 By default (when :c:member:`~PyMemberDef.flags` is ``0``), members allow
485 ``PyMemberDef`` may contain a definition for the special member
490 static PyMemberDef spam_type_members[] = {
506 ``PyMemberDef`` is always available.
509 .. c:function:: PyObject* PyMember_GetOne(const char *obj_addr, struct PyMemberDef *m)
512 attribute is described by ``PyMemberDef`` *m*. Returns ``NULL``
[all …]
Ddescriptor.rst21 .. c:function:: PyObject* PyDescr_NewMember(PyTypeObject *type, struct PyMemberDef *meth)
/external/python/cpython3/Modules/_testcapi/
Dheaptype.c335 static struct PyMemberDef members_to_repeat[] = {
480 static struct PyMemberDef heapctype_members[] = {
574 static struct PyMemberDef heapctypesubclass_members[] = {
724 sizeof(PyMemberDef),
743 sizeof(PyMemberDef),
775 static struct PyMemberDef heapctypewithdict_members[] = {
870 static struct PyMemberDef heapctypewithnegativedict_members[] = {
896 static struct PyMemberDef heapctypewithweakref_members[] = {
946 static struct PyMemberDef heapctypesetattr_members[] = {
Dstructmember.c33 static struct PyMemberDef test_members_newapi[] = {
119 static struct PyMemberDef test_members[] = {
Dbuffer.c76 static struct PyMemberDef testbuf_members[] = {
/external/python/cpython3/Objects/
Dstructseq.c543 static PyMemberDef *
547 PyMemberDef *members; in initialize_members()
549 members = PyMem_NEW(PyMemberDef, n_members - n_unnamed_members + 1); in initialize_members()
579 PyMemberDef *tp_members, Py_ssize_t n_members, in initialize_static_fields()
628 PyMemberDef *members = NULL; in _PyStructSequence_InitBuiltinWithFlags()
679 PyMemberDef *members; in PyStructSequence_InitType2()
751 PyMemberDef *members; in _PyStructSequence_NewType()
Dclassobject.c155 static PyMemberDef method_memberlist[] = {
388 static PyMemberDef instancemethod_memberlist[] = {
Dexceptions.c442 static struct PyMemberDef BaseException_members[] = {
576 static PyMemberDef StopIteration_members[] = {
678 static PyMemberDef SystemExit_members[] = {
1470 static PyMemberDef BaseExceptionGroup_members[] = {
1647 static PyMemberDef ImportError_members[] = {
2096 static PyMemberDef OSError_members[] = {
2246 static PyMemberDef NameError_members[] = {
2365 static PyMemberDef AttributeError_members[] = {
2538 static PyMemberDef SyntaxError_members[] = {
2912 static PyMemberDef UnicodeError_members[] = {
Dtypevarobject.c317 static PyMemberDef typevar_members[] = {
729 static PyMemberDef paramspecattr_members[] = {
961 static PyMemberDef paramspec_members[] = {
1283 static PyMemberDef typevartuple_members[] = {
1575 static PyMemberDef typealias_members[] = {
/external/python/cpython3/Python/
Dstructmember.c12 member_get_object(const char *addr, const char *obj_addr, PyMemberDef *l) in member_get_object()
24 PyMember_GetOne(const char *obj_addr, PyMemberDef *l) in PyMember_GetOne()
130 PyMember_SetOne(char *addr, PyMemberDef *l, PyObject *v) in PyMember_SetOne()
/external/pytorch/torch/csrc/utils/
Dpyobject_preservation.cpp7 PyMemberDef* mp = type->tp_members; in clear_slots()
/external/python/cpython3/Include/cpython/
Ddescrobject.h46 PyMemberDef *d_member;
/external/python/cpython3/Doc/includes/
Dtypestruct.h58 struct PyMemberDef *tp_members;
/external/python/cpython3/Doc/includes/newtypes/
Dcustom2.c61 static PyMemberDef Custom_members[] = {
Dcustom3.c61 static PyMemberDef Custom_members[] = {
Dcustom4.c77 static PyMemberDef Custom_members[] = {
/external/pytorch/torch/csrc/xpu/
DStream.cpp118 static struct PyMemberDef THXPStream_members[] = {{nullptr}};
/external/pytorch/torch/csrc/cuda/
DStream.cpp135 static struct PyMemberDef THCPStream_members[] = {{nullptr}};
/external/python/cpython3/Modules/
Dxxsubtype.c186 static PyMemberDef spamdict_members[] = {
/external/brotli/python/
D_brotli.cc338 static PyMemberDef brotli_Compressor_members[] = {
566 static PyMemberDef brotli_Decompressor_members[] = {
/external/pytorch/torch/csrc/fx/
Dnode.cpp36 static struct PyMemberDef NodeBase_members[] = {

12345